Here to help us ruin our resolutions: The Guadalajaran, one of Vidorra’s two large-format cocktails meant to be enjoyed by three or more people. Tequila, mezcal, fruit juice and squirt make for a highly spirited cocktail that will lift your spirits after that three-day attempt at a “new year, new you.”
The Guadalajaran ($60): Cazadores Reposado, Casamigos Mezcal, pineapple juice, citrus, Squirt
Vidorra, 2642 Main St. (Deep Ellum)
